West Island is small and can be easily explored on foot or by bicycle.





West Island serves as the main settlement of the Cocos (Keeling) Islands, offering a serene escape for those looking to experience the beauty of a remote island. The island is characterized by its pristine beaches, clear turquoise waters, and lush natural landscapes. Visitors can enjoy a peaceful retreat, exploring the island's unique wildlife and engaging in water activities such as snorkeling and diving. With its laid-back atmosphere, West Island is perfect for travelers who appreciate tranquility and the beauty of untouched nature.
